Ecstasy Behind the Forgotten is a gritty dive into the murky waters of toxic masculinity, directed by Nora Stock. The film’s atmosphere is heavy, almost suffocating at times, which echoes the internal struggles the characters endure. It’s not just about the women affected; the men's journey is equally haunting and thought-provoking.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ing the weight of jealousy and insecurity to settle in the viewer's mind. The performances are raw, striking a balance between vulnerability and aggression that really brings the themes home. The practical effects, though minimal, are used effectively to enhance the emotional impact rather than distract. There’s a distinct lack of glorification here, making it a compelling watch for anyone interested in the complexities of gender dynamics.
